HTC EVO 3500mAh extended battery photos revealed
3 Attachment(s)
We've always known that Seidio had an Innocell 3500mAh extended battery in the works for the HTC EVO, and while we still don't know the price or release date, we now at least know what it looks like thanks to some new photos the company has just added to its website.
This extended battery has more than twice the capacity of the EVO's stock 1500mAh battery, so it adds considerable bulk to the device (unlike the slim 1750mAh battery) and of course requires that you ditch the phone's original backplate for Seidio's replacement. The new soft-touch back will be bundled with the battery, so the only thing you'll need to worry about is finding compatible accessories and deciding whether all that extra runtime is worth the hump on your EVO's back. http://www.mobilecityonline.com/wire...mpaign=froogle |
